
高效时间任务调度-洞察分析.pptx
35页数智创新 变革未来,高效时间任务调度,时间任务调度概述 任务调度策略分析 调度算法性能评估 高效调度机制设计 资源分配与优化 实时任务调度技术 并发任务调度方法 调度系统稳定性保障,Contents Page,目录页,时间任务调度概述,高效时间任务调度,时间任务调度概述,时间任务调度的定义与重要性,1.时间任务调度是指在特定时间点执行特定任务的机制,它是现代计算机系统和网络环境中确保任务按计划执行的关键技术2.时间任务调度的重要性体现在提高系统资源利用效率、保证系统稳定性和可靠性,以及满足实时性要求等方面3.随着云计算、大数据和物联网等技术的发展,时间任务调度在提升系统性能、降低运维成本方面发挥着越来越重要的作用时间任务调度的基本原理,1.时间任务调度基于任务优先级、执行时间窗口、资源可用性等原则,通过算法实现任务的合理分配和执行2.基本原理包括任务分解、时间分割、负载均衡等,这些原理保证了任务的按时完成和系统资源的合理利用3.随着人工智能和机器学习技术的发展,时间任务调度的基本原理也在不断优化,以适应更加复杂和动态的环境时间任务调度概述,时间任务调度的挑战与解决方案,1.时间任务调度面临的挑战包括任务冲突、资源竞争、实时性要求等,这些挑战对系统的性能和稳定性构成威胁。
2.解决方案包括引入新的调度算法、优化任务分配策略、采用实时调度技术等,以应对这些挑战3.随着边缘计算和分布式系统的兴起,针对这些新兴技术的解决方案也在不断涌现,以满足不断增长的计算需求时间任务调度算法的研究与应用,1.时间任务调度算法是时间任务调度的核心,包括基于优先级、基于轮询、基于启发式等方法2.研究这些算法的目的是提高任务执行效率,降低系统延迟,并保证系统资源的合理分配3.应用领域涵盖云计算、大数据处理、实时系统等多个方面,体现了算法的广泛适用性时间任务调度概述,时间任务调度的实时性与性能优化,1.实时性是时间任务调度的关键特性,要求系统能够在规定时间内完成任务,以满足实时应用的需求2.性能优化包括降低任务执行延迟、减少资源消耗、提高系统吞吐量等,这些优化措施对提高系统整体性能至关重要3.随着边缘计算和5G通信的发展,实时性和性能优化成为时间任务调度研究的热点时间任务调度的安全性与隐私保护,1.时间任务调度涉及大量敏感数据,其安全性直接影响系统的可靠性和用户隐私2.安全性措施包括数据加密、访问控制、审计日志等,以防止未授权访问和数据泄露3.随着网络安全威胁的日益严峻,时间任务调度的安全性和隐私保护成为研究的重要方向。
任务调度策略分析,高效时间任务调度,任务调度策略分析,1.基于任务重要性和紧迫性进行优先级划分,确保关键任务优先执行2.采用动态调整机制,根据任务执行情况实时调整优先级,适应实时变化的需求3.引入机器学习算法,通过历史数据预测任务执行时间,优化任务调度策略资源感知调度策略,1.考虑系统资源利用情况,合理分配计算、存储和网络资源,提高资源利用率2.集成云资源管理技术,实现弹性伸缩,适应不同负载需求3.运用大数据分析技术,对资源使用模式进行预测,优化资源调度策略任务优先级调度策略,任务调度策略分析,多粒度调度策略,1.采用多粒度任务分解,将大任务分解为小任务,提高调度灵活性2.结合任务依赖关系,构建任务调度图,优化任务执行顺序3.运用图论算法,分析任务调度图,实现高效的任务调度自适应调度策略,1.根据系统性能和任务执行反馈,自适应调整调度策略,提高系统响应速度2.采用自适应学习算法,通过不断学习系统运行状态,优化调度决策3.引入多智能体系统,实现任务调度策略的协同优化任务调度策略分析,负载均衡调度策略,1.通过负载均衡技术,将任务均匀分配到不同节点,避免单点过载2.结合节点性能和任务特点,动态调整负载分配策略,提高系统吞吐量。
3.运用网络流理论,实现跨网络的负载均衡,优化全局性能绿色调度策略,1.考虑能耗和环境影响,实现绿色计算资源分配,降低系统能耗2.引入虚拟化技术,优化硬件资源使用,减少能源消耗3.运用能效评估模型,实时监控和评估系统能耗,持续优化调度策略调度算法性能评估,高效时间任务调度,调度算法性能评估,调度算法性能评估指标体系,1.完整性:评估指标应全面覆盖调度算法的性能表现,包括但不限于响应时间、吞吐量、资源利用率、任务完成率和系统稳定性等2.可量化性:指标应具有明确的量化标准,便于进行数值比较和分析,提高评估的科学性和客观性3.动态适应性:指标体系应能够适应不同应用场景和任务类型的变化,具备一定的灵活性调度算法性能评估方法,1.实验设计:通过设计合理的实验场景,模拟实际运行环境,确保评估结果的可靠性和有效性2.比较分析:采用多种评估方法,如统计分析、对比实验等,对不同调度算法的性能进行横向和纵向比较3.持续优化:根据评估结果不断调整和优化调度算法,提高其性能调度算法性能评估,1.数据来源:数据收集应多元化,包括历史运行数据、模拟数据、实际运行数据等,确保数据的全面性和代表性2.数据质量:确保收集到的数据准确、完整、可靠,避免因数据质量问题导致评估结果失真。
3.数据处理:对收集到的数据进行预处理,如去噪、归一化等,以提高评估的准确性和效率调度算法性能评估工具与技术,1.仿真技术:利用仿真工具模拟调度算法的运行过程,提供可视化的性能评估结果2.机器学习:运用机器学习算法对调度算法性能进行预测和优化,提高评估的准确性和预测能力3.云计算平台:利用云计算平台进行大规模的调度算法性能评估实验,提高评估的效率和可扩展性调度算法性能评估数据收集,调度算法性能评估,调度算法性能评估趋势与前沿,1.能源效率:随着绿色计算的兴起,调度算法的能源效率成为评估的重要指标,关注算法在降低能耗方面的表现2.自适应调度:研究自适应调度算法,使算法能够根据任务特性和系统状态动态调整调度策略,提高性能3.跨域调度:探讨跨域调度算法,实现不同计算资源之间的协同调度,提高资源利用率调度算法性能评估在实际应用中的挑战,1.复杂性:实际应用中的调度场景复杂多变,调度算法需要具备较强的适应性和鲁棒性2.安全性:在调度过程中,确保数据安全和系统稳定性是评估的重要挑战3.可扩展性:随着计算资源的不断增加,调度算法需要具备良好的可扩展性,以应对大规模任务调度需求高效调度机制设计,高效时间任务调度,高效调度机制设计,任务优先级分配机制,1.优先级分配基于任务的紧急程度和重要性。
紧急且重要的任务应优先处理,以最大化资源利用效率2.采用动态调整策略,根据系统负载和任务执行情况实时调整任务优先级3.引入机器学习算法,通过分析历史数据预测任务执行时间,优化优先级分配策略多任务并行处理技术,1.利用多核处理器并行处理多个任务,提高任务执行速度2.设计高效的任务调度算法,确保任务分配合理,避免资源竞争和冲突3.采用负载均衡技术,根据处理器负载动态调整任务分配,实现资源最大化利用高效调度机制设计,1.将复杂任务分解为多个子任务,降低任务执行难度,提高并行处理能力2.合理组合子任务,形成高效的执行序列,减少任务切换开销3.引入任务依赖关系分析,确保子任务执行顺序正确,提高任务完成率资源管理策略,1.根据任务需求动态分配资源,实现资源优化配置2.采用资源预留机制,确保关键任务在执行过程中获得所需资源3.引入资源回收策略,释放未使用的资源,提高系统整体资源利用率任务分解与组合,高效调度机制设计,任务调度可视化技术,1.利用可视化工具展示任务调度过程,便于分析问题和优化调度策略2.实时监控任务执行情况,及时发现潜在瓶颈,进行动态调整3.结合大数据分析技术,挖掘任务调度规律,为调度策略优化提供数据支持。
容错与故障恢复机制,1.设计容错机制,确保任务在遇到故障时能够自动恢复或重试2.引入故障检测技术,及时发现并隔离故障,降低系统故障率3.优化故障恢复策略,提高系统稳定性和可靠性资源分配与优化,高效时间任务调度,资源分配与优化,动态资源分配策略,1.根据任务优先级动态调整资源分配,确保高优先级任务获得更多资源支持2.实施资源监控机制,实时跟踪资源使用情况,防止资源过度消耗或闲置3.采用机器学习算法预测任务执行时间,优化资源分配策略,提高资源利用效率资源池化管理,1.建立统一的资源池,实现资源的集中管理和调度,提高资源利用率2.采用虚拟化技术,将物理资源抽象为虚拟资源,灵活分配给不同任务3.资源池动态扩展和收缩,根据实际需求自动调整资源规模,降低运维成本资源分配与优化,多维度资源评估模型,1.从性能、可靠性、成本等多个维度评估资源,为资源分配提供科学依据2.结合历史数据,建立资源性能预测模型,优化资源分配决策3.引入用户反馈机制,实时调整资源评估模型,提高模型准确性和适应性负载均衡与优化,1.实施负载均衡算法,合理分配任务到不同节点,避免单点过载2.采用自适应负载均衡技术,根据任务执行情况动态调整负载分配策略。
3.结合云计算和边缘计算,实现全局负载均衡,提高系统整体性能资源分配与优化,1.集成绿色节能算法,降低资源消耗,实现可持续发展2.利用节能设备和技术,如动态电源管理,减少能源浪费3.通过资源调度优化,实现绿色数据中心建设和运营跨域资源协同调度,1.实现跨地域、跨平台资源的协同调度,提高资源利用率和系统可靠性2.采用分布式调度框架,支持大规模资源池的统一管理和调度3.引入边缘计算,优化跨域资源调度,降低网络延迟和数据传输成本绿色节能资源调度,实时任务调度技术,高效时间任务调度,实时任务调度技术,实时任务调度技术的概念与特点,1.实时任务调度技术是一种针对实时系统的高效调度方法,旨在确保任务能够在规定的时间内完成,以满足实时系统的实时性需求2.与传统调度技术相比,实时任务调度更加注重任务的响应时间和确定性,要求系统能够在规定时间内响应并处理任务3.实时任务调度技术通常采用抢占式调度或固定优先级调度等策略,以确保任务的及时性和系统的稳定性实时任务调度算法,1.实时任务调度算法是实时任务调度技术的核心,主要包括抢占式调度算法和固定优先级调度算法等2.抢占式调度算法能够在任务执行过程中根据优先级动态调整任务的执行顺序,提高系统的灵活性和响应速度。
3.固定优先级调度算法则根据任务优先级静态分配CPU时间片,适用于任务优先级稳定且变化不大的实时系统实时任务调度技术,实时任务调度中的资源管理,1.实时任务调度需要合理管理系统资源,如CPU时间、内存和I/O等,以确保任务的高效执行2.资源管理策略包括资源预留、动态分配和优先级继承等,旨在减少任务间的冲突和竞争,提高系统性能3.资源管理技术需要考虑任务的实时性需求和系统负载,实现资源的合理分配和动态调整实时任务调度中的负载均衡,1.实时任务调度需要实现负载均衡,以避免系统过载或资源浪费,提高系统的整体性能2.负载均衡技术通过动态分配任务到不同的处理器或计算节点,实现任务执行时间的优化3.负载均衡策略包括基于优先级、基于资源消耗和基于执行时间等,以适应不同的实时系统需求实时任务调度技术,实时任务调度在分布式系统中的应用,1.实时任务调度技术在分布式系统中发挥着重要作用,能够提高分布式系统的实时性和可靠性2.分布式实时任务调度需要考虑网络延迟、节点故障和任务分布等因素,设计高效的调度策略3.分布式实时任务调度技术包括全局调度、局部调度和混合调度等,以适应不同规模和复杂度的分布式系统实时任务调度与人工智能技术的结合,1.将人工智能技术应用于实时任务调度,可以实现对任务执行过程的智能分析和预测,提高调度效率。
2.人工智能技术在实时任务调度中的应用包括机器学习、深度。












